Output ec57daa88e102a27e4039bc45affc729cf85b6bfe0afb894921d3fa3ce0e738e:0

value
1452489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f46b0e3a1149ee07aa2e7a384f7ce549377c2a6 OP_EQUAL
address
3EkbEfqcVR6MeGnZLbNhY46S67j7A3mGst
transaction
ec57daa88e102a27e4039bc45affc729cf85b6bfe0afb894921d3fa3ce0e738e
spent
true